Mired in Sin City’s suburbs, Clay tries to live his life while still trapped in the skin of his infamous character.
You remember: the adult nursery rhymes, the insults, the ban from MTV, the deliberate controversy.
He works to pay back his gambling debts, manage his sons’ heavy metal band and fend off pumped-up fans — all while sporting his trademark black leather jacket and fingerless gloves, poised for a comeback.
